UPDATED:
- North Korea says it has conducted a successful underground hydrogen bomb test, a first for the nation
- A hydrogen bomb is more powerful than plutonium weapons, which is what North Korea used in its past nuclear tests
- The U.S. says it may take days to confirm the claim
- Countries in the region issue strong condemnation and hold emergency meetigs

- earthquake of a magnitude of 5.1 has been registered near Punggye-ri, North Korea
- North Korea is believed to have conducted three underground nuclear tests since 2006, all at a site called Punggye-ri
- China, Japan and South Korea have said that there are indications pointing at a man-made tremor what hints to North Korea having carried out a nuclear test
- North Korean state media has said a "special, significant" announcement will be made shortly
- Japan's chief cabinet secretary Yuga Yoshihide said:
"considering past cases, there is the possibility that this might be a nuclear test by North Korea"
